"Beautiful People" is the debut, self-penned, 1990 single by the group Stress. It failed to make a serious chart impact, reaching No.74 on the UK singles chart for a single week on 13 October 1990.
The closing refrain of the song is notable for featuring lines from Strawberry Fields Forever
